Although not, using these details isn’t in the place of their complications. Although latest research centers on the methods one battle-Blackness in particular-is actually taken fully to, there isn’t any genuine way of surveying the fresh new ethnic, racial, gender, sexuality, or other social identifications of members. In his twitter study out-of linguistic presentation of null victims in the several types of Language, Adrian Rodriguez Riccelli (2018) cards brand new drawbacks of employing on the web language data from the detailing that “[o]ne downside to that strategy ‘s the issue inside accessing sociolinguistic and code history, along with biographical guidance. Advice released to the a great user’s profile could be wrong otherwise absent all together that will be already not easily extracted. Still, the newest cousin ease of access and you may extortionate levels of studies makes getting an enticing equipment useful. For as long as its limitations is accepted” (p. 311). Inside our situation, the extraction out of high-measure ideological buildings can still be attained, regardless if we’re not capable quickly assess the ways that almost every other characteristics such as gender otherwise sociocultural subjectivity impact the pronouncements. Subsequent, the use of discussion investigation depends on the language are introduced, leaving place to possess an analysis from non-spoken communications about production of ethno-racial ideologies on these platforms. Nonetheless, making use of the modern methodology allows us to circulate beyond anecdotal otherwise interviews study off racial ideologies by Paraguayan schГ¶ne Frauen giving usage of considerable amounts of information with relative simplicity. Afterwards, so it work could well be alongside digital media degree examining the latest ways subject positionality says to social networking communications to help you submit a framework having knowing the personal nature of competition build in these platforms.

Across the entire research set (having films and you can comments), there is certainly a maximum of 933 excerpts, and therefore yielded 925 tokens of your focal raciolinguistic ideologies recognized. Desk step three will bring a complete post on what amount of minutes for each raciolinguistic ideology looked. DNA ideology was the most typical that have 535 appearances. This was directly with categorization fallacy which have 372. Complete, the info put implies that folks are nevertheless greatly intent on discussing and you may sharing both medical battle and the progressive conceptions of nation state and you will title. Code, likewise, took a backseat during the talks in the competition, having co-naturalization away from code and battle merely presenting 16 tokens and accent ideology promoting 2. The fresh ideologies is discussed under control regarding magnitude, with the most regular happening very first.

3.1. DNA Ideology

If you are societal researchers and biggest scholarly groups to which they belong keeps basically gone off battle since the a physiological or scientific design (Morning 2007), a keen adherence so you can eugenic and scientific methods from race persevere (Omi and you will Winant 2014; Early morning 2007; Williams 2013). Such notions is reified as a consequence of public narratives away from name predicated on DNA comparison, in the course of time linking living sciences to help you prominent society (Nelson 2016; Yudell mais aussi al. 2016; Roth and you can Ive). DNA ideologies was the most frequent in today’s research lay, which have genetics given that a sign of racial belonging appearing normally in the talks away from ethno-racial belonging. For this reason, even with an obvious shift inside the educational information about competition, scientific race is not only persisting, it is controling information from the label and you will that belong. Records so you can DNA, blood, African, Indian, and you can Western european origins and you may lifestyle was in fact every titled on to examine otherwise contest Blackness for Dominicans for the island and also in the Us (1).dos Moreover, we see mention of the DNA as the something is actually measurable, contained in the qualifier “more”.
